To add a footer number in Google Docs: First, click on 'Insert' in the menu bar. Then, choose 'Header & page number' and select 'Page number.' Pick the format you prefer, and the page numbers will be added to the footer of your document automatically. This process helps in maintaining consistent pagination across your document.**

FAQs & Answers

  1. Can I customize the position of page numbers in Google Docs? Yes, Google Docs allows you to place page numbers in the header or footer and select different numbering styles.
  2. How do I start page numbering from a specific page in Google Docs? You can insert section breaks and then format page numbers separately to start numbering from a chosen page.
  3. Is it possible to remove page numbers after adding them in Google Docs? Yes, simply go to 'Insert' > 'Header & page number' > 'Page number' and select 'Remove page numbers' to delete them.
